powerpc/83xx: Add USB Host/Gadget support for MPC8360E-MDS boards
authorAnton Vorontsov <avorontsov@ru.mvista.com>
Thu, 18 Dec 2008 16:37:31 +0000 (19:37 +0300)
committerKumar Gala <galak@kernel.crashing.org>
Tue, 30 Dec 2008 17:13:46 +0000 (11:13 -0600)
- Update the device tree per QE USB bindings;
- Add timer (FSL GTM) node;
- Add gpio-controller node for BCSR13 bank (GPIOs on that bank
  are used to control the USB transceiver);
- Set up other BCSR registers;
- Configure the QE Par IO.

The work is loosely based on Li Yang's patch[1], which was used
to support peripheral mode only.
